<p><strong>CI Azumano&nbsp;</strong>is seeking a <strong>Government Travel Consultant</strong> to support our military customer. This is an on-site position at Fort Lewis in Tacoma, WA.</p> <p>The <strong>Government Travel Consultant</strong> provides professional travel service assistance to specific federal government agencies, as prescribed in active service contracts.</p> <p><strong><u>Roles and Responsibilities include, but are not limited to</u></strong>:</p> <ul> <li>Secure air, car and hotel accommodations for contracted government agencies.</li> <li>Ensure that all aspects of booked travel (domestic and international) adhere to all government travel regulations, and validate that a high quality of accommodation and transportation is secured.</li> <li>Ensure all queues are maintained throughout the day.</li> <li>Initiate cancellation or reservation change processes to their completion, where applicable, to include expedient client agency notification.</li> <li>Provide updates, as necessary, to client agencies to ensure their full awareness of information and status relating to the pending travel.</li> <li>Conduct routine research of travel industry changes, trends and offerings to ensure they are working with the most up-to-date information when advising client agencies.</li> <li>Maintain a professional customer service attitude and demeanor at all times while providing quality service, timely and accurate completion of travel arrangements and recommending value-added services to the client agency</li> </ul> <p><strong><u>Basic Qualifications:</u></strong></p> <ul> <li>High School Diploma or GED</li> </ul> <p><strong><u>Competencies/Job Knowledge</u></strong></p> <ul> <li>Travel industry experience</li> <li>Proactive approach to systems and processes.</li> <li>Working knowledge of WorldSpan and SABRE GDS</li> <li>Written and verbal communication skills&nbsp;</li> <li>Customer service skills</li> <li>Positive attitude</li> </ul><div class="content-conclusion"><p><strong><u></u></strong></p> <p><strong><u>Equal Opportunity Statement:</u></strong><br>Seneca Holdings provides equal employment opportunities to all employees and applicants without regard to race, color, religion, sex/gender, sexual orientation, national origin, age, disability, marital status, genetic information and/or predisposing genetic characteristics, victim of domestic violence status, veteran status, or other protected class status. About Seneca Holdings

The Seneca Nation Group (SNG) is the federal government contracting business of Seneca Holdings, which is wholly owned by the Seneca Nation. We meet the mission-critical needs of our Federal Civilian, Defense, and Intelligence Community customers across a variety of domains. Our portfolio is comprised of multiple companies that participate in the Small Business Administration 8(a) program. It is our mission to improve the economy of the Seneca Nation by providing products and services that support the critical missions of our federal government customers. SNG generates over $270 million in annual revenue from diverse business enterprises focused in both commercial and government markets that directly supports over 8,500 Seneca shareholders.
